What Is the Definition of Retardation?

Answer – In physics, retardation refers to the reduction of the velocity of a body over time.

Explanation: 

When the final velocity of a body is less than its initial velocity, the body is said to be under retardation. Retardation is essentially a form of negative acceleration, acting in the opposite direction of motion to reduce the velocity of the object

It is calculated using the formula for acceleration a = v − u/t, where a is the retardation, v is the final velocity, u is the initial velocity, and t is the time taken. This formula helps determine the rate at which an object slows down.
